Output e53ec7dc82275ffc5590965f2b97e2ef6c8a7a02b14b68ab8dbf52291ad63a24:0

value
43813134159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5010f75b23c7d9f54fdecbbd32677addf4dd0617 OP_EQUAL
address
38zNJizZ9bfQ79RCytd32hyWzFEpVapsC4
transaction
e53ec7dc82275ffc5590965f2b97e2ef6c8a7a02b14b68ab8dbf52291ad63a24
spent
true